Ceramic tipped pivot rod and method for its manufacture

A pivot rod is described comprising: a mounting shaft having an interior receiving space at at least one end thereof; a pivot insert formed of a ceramic material having a maximum tensile principle stress, the pivot insert being positioned with a first portion thereof disposed within the receiving space and a second portion thereof projecting axially beyond the end of the mounting shaft; an interference fit securement between the first portion of the pivot insert and a peripheral wall of the mounting shaft circumscribing the receiving space, the interference fit securement being constructed as a means for preventing the maximum tensile principle stress of the ceramic material from being exceeded.
